Job Description
As HR Manager, you will act as the primary HR point of contact in Italy, ensuring the effective and efficient delivery of day-to-day HR services.
This includes overseeing payroll operations, ensuring compliance with local social legislation, and managing constructive dialogue with employee representatives and unions.
In this role, you will drive the local implementation of global HR programs while supporting operational business needs You will partner closely with managers and employees across Italy, providing hands-on HR guidance and ensuring a consistent and high-quality employee experience.
Reporting to the Lead HR Business Partner for Global Operations, you will play a key role in translating HR strategy into impactful local execution, contributing to both business performance and employee engagement
Main Accountabilities
- Ensure the timely and accurate delivery of all local payroll activities and related processes, fully compliant with Italian labour and social legislation.
- Provide dedicated HR support and guidance to the local management team, addressing people-related needs and driving the effective execution of HR actions.
- Lead local internal communication efforts, ensuring effective cascading of global and local messages, and supporting employer and employee branding initiatives.
- Collaborate closely with the Lead HR Business Partner (Operations & Healthcare) to align on HR priorities, strategies, and key initiatives.
- Oversee and continuously improve HR processes throughout the employee lifecycle, while coaching people leaders and key talents on topics such as performance, development, and career growth.
- Act as the primary point of contact for local unions and external stakeholders (e.g. trade unions, Confindustria), fostering constructive and compliant industrial relations.
- Monitor and actively support employee engagement initiatives, ensuring timely follow-up on feedback and action plans.
- Partner with HR Centres of Expertise to co-create and implement innovative HR solutions and effectively deploy global HR programs in Italy.
- Monitor and stimulate organizational performance through data-driven insights and targeted HR interventions.
Education
- Master’s degree in human resources, Social Sciences, Business Management, or a related field, or an equivalent combination of relevant qualifications and experience
Experience
- Proven experience in an HR support role within an international and matrixed environment, with a solid track record in operational HR management.
- Demonstrated hands-on expertise in delivering core HR services, including payroll coordination, employee relations, and compliance with local labour legislation.
- Experience supporting business leaders and employees across different functions, translating business needs into effective HR actions and solutions.
- Familiarity with working in a complex stakeholder landscape, with the ability to balance global HR frameworks and local requirements.
- Track record of contributing to or implementing HR initiatives and processes, ensuring high-quality execution and continuous improvement.
Competencies
- Proven expertise in payroll processes and Italian labour law, complemented by experience in at least two additional HR domains (e.g. staffing, HRIS, training & development, organizational development, HR business partnering)
- Fluent in Italian and English, both written and spoken, with the ability to communicate effectively across different audiences and organizational levels
- Acts with integrity, strong ethical standards, and a results-driven mindset
- Strong organizational, planning, and problem-solving skills, with the ability to effectively prioritize
- Builds trusted partnerships with stakeholders through a strong customer focus, collaborative mindset, and delivery orientation
- Excellent communication and presentation skills, with the ability to influence stakeholders through well-structured and thoughtful recommendations
- Strong listening, negotiation, and interpersonal skills
- Solid conflict management capabilities
